1. An article vending and accounting system, comprising(a) a plurality of vending machines each containing different kinds of merchandise which may be freely selected by a customer,(b) a merchandise code generator disposed within each vending machine for generating a merchandise code of a merchandise item selected by the customer,(c) first connection means disposed within each vending machine,(d) a plurality of memory holders each of which may be carried by a customer for permitting the selection of merchandise when connected to said first connection means,(e) memory means such as a shift register disposed within each of said memory holders for storing therein the merchandise code transmitted from said merchandise code generator,(f) means for transmitting the merchandise data generated by the code generator,(g) switching means disposed within each memory holder for enabling the storage in and read out from said memory means of merchandise data transmitted from said merchandise code generator when said switching means is activated,(h) an accounting machine for reading the merchandise codes stored in said memory means in the memory holder when connected thereto for preparing a bill, and(i) actuating means disposed adjacent to said first connection means of the vending machine and a second connection means of said accounting machine for activating said switching means when the memory holder is connected to said first or second connection means.
